Ellendale-Edgeley-Kulm junior Clayton Grueneich continued his dome dominance. Grueneich earned a 13-3 major decision against Velva senior Justin Helseth to earn the state championship at 195 pounds.
"It feels pretty good ... no feeling like it in the world," Grueneich said. "Introductions even (were) awesome. It was fun."
In November, Grueneich led E-E-K to a Class 1A state football championship with a dominating performance. He rushed for 343 yards and five touchdowns in a 42-20 victory against Des Lacs-Burlington in the title game.
"They're both awesome in their own ways," Grueneich said. "Winning it by myself is awesome, but then winning it with my teammates is awesome, too."
Grueneich (37-0) capped off an undefeated wrestling season with his victory in the state championship match.
"I had goals, but probably not this high," Grueneich said.
